ISBN: 9780743241908
Authors: Dan Rather, CBS News
Publisher: Simon & Schuster
Date of Publication: 2002-08-20
Format: Hardcover
Related Collections: Politics, History
Related Topics: History, Journalism, Politics
Goodreads rating: 4.17
(rated by 242 readers)

Description

A historical record of the events of September 11 and what was learned from them is culled from the CBS News archives and includes a full-length DVD of video footage. 250,000 first printing.
